Ehup guys, on a job at the moment , i am struggling with the dreaded coni pipe. No waste pipes anywhere near. I had bought a condensate soakaway , but it has to go in a concrete drive ( oh joy ) and under the concrete there is a gas pipe, somewhere !!

A nats less than 3 meters away there is a rainwater fall pipe, I know it shouldnt go into to it, but its going to be one hell of a lot easier.

Come on own up what would you do , soakaway or fall pipe ???
 
Big detached, soil pipe opp end to boiler, boiler is downstairs in a converted garage now a kids play room. To get coni pipe to stack would still be a git , loft has just been insulated 300 mm everywhere , plus a pipe going through his daughters bedroom , he wont go for it.

Scots idea of the neutraliser sounds favourite , never done it , never had a house as difficult as this to get rid of the condensate .
 
Run it internal as far as possible & take into down pipe... Or, upsize & run external...

A soak away in the ground where there is a gas pipe might be a disaster waiting to happen? Espocally if its a metal pipe...

Yep I had thought of that as well as potentially 6'' of concrete lol
 
sauerman condense and prv pump has a nuetraliser in it, fish the hose through the roof/floorspace and into the rainwater
 
If you can establish the rain water and foul water are combined then you could terminate it into the same outside..
 
I had the manhole cover up today, they are combined and less than 2 meters from my intended inlet into the fall pipe, decision was made this afternoon ..... Its going in the fall pipe.
